    According to CNN in December of last year Senator Bernie Sanders (I-VT) told his rival for the affections of the hard left Dem primary vote, Senator Elizabeth Warren (D-Mass), that a woman could not win the 2020 race for the White House.

    Ah, those old socialists. Just not woke enough.

    Sanders responded in a recent statement to Fox News, "It is ludicrous to believe that at the same meeting where Elizabeth Warren told me she was going to run for president, I would tell her that a woman couldn't win. It's sad that, three weeks before the Iowa caucus and a year after that private conversation, staff who weren't in the room are lying about what happened."

    Warren subtly countered on Sunday, "I was disappointed to hear that Bernie is sending his volunteers out to trash me. Bernie knows me and has known me for a long time. He knows who I am, where I come from, what I have worked on and fought for."

    But on Monday she went for broke, "Among the topics that came up was what would happen if Democrats nominated a female candidate. I thought a woman could win; he disagreed."
